H. Yoshiki et al., SUPER-WIDE ELECTRON-CYCLOTRON-RESONANCE PLASMA SOURCE EXCITED BY AN INDEPENDENT DOUBLE-SLOT ANTENNA, JPN J A P 2, 36(10A), 1997, pp. 1347-1350
In this paper we describe an improved super-wide electron cyclotron re
sonance (ECR) plasma source which consists of permanent magnets, a sol
enoid coil and an independently excited double-slot antenna. Each slot
antenna is prepared in the side wall of the rectangular waveguide pos
itioned so that the two slot antennas are parallel and shifted by the
distance of lambda(g)/4 (lambda(g): waveguide wavelength) from each ot
her. An 800-mm-wide (one-dimensional distributed) plasma of oxygen gas
is produced, and an ion current density uniformity within +/-5% over
770 mm in length can be obtained.
